linux系统基础命令练习题
-
题目1:如何查看Linux系统的进程列表?
答:可以使用命令”ps -ef”来查看Linux系统的进程列表。
2年前 -
1. 如何查看当前的工作目录?
答:可以使用命令pwd来查看当前的工作目录。只需在终端中输入pwd并按下回车,系统将会显示当前所在的目录。2. 如何创建一个新的目录?
答:可以使用命令mkdir来创建一个新的目录。只需在终端中输入mkdir [目录名]并按下回车,系统将会在当前目录下创建一个新的目录。3. 如何进入一个目录?
答:可以使用命令cd来进入一个目录。只需在终端中输入cd [目录名]并按下回车,系统将会进入该目录。4. 如何列出当前目录下的文件和子目录?
答:可以使用命令ls来列出当前目录下的文件和子目录。只需在终端中输入ls并按下回车,系统将会显示当前目录下的所有文件和子目录。5. 如何复制文件或目录?
答:可以使用命令cp来复制文件或目录。只需在终端中输入cp [源文件/目录] [目标文件/目录]并按下回车,系统将会将源文件或目录复制到目标文件或目录中。2年前 -
练习题1:文件操作命令
1. 创建一个名为”test”的文件夹。
2. 在”test”文件夹中创建一个名为”file1.txt”的文件。
3. 在”test”文件夹中创建一个名为”file2.txt”的文件。
4. 将”test”文件夹中的所有文件复制到一个名为”backup”的文件夹中。
5. 删除”test”文件夹及其下所有文件。练习题2:文件查找命令
1. 在当前目录中查找包含关键词”hello”的所有文件。
2. 在当前目录及其子目录中查找所有以”.txt”为后缀的文件。
3. 查找当前用户家目录下最近7天内所修改的所有文件。练习题3:文件权限命令
1. 创建一个名为”test.txt”的文件,并将其权限设置为只能由所有者读写,其他用户只能读取。
2. 查看”test.txt”的权限。
3. 修改”test.txt”的权限,使其仅有所有者拥有可执行权限。
4. 将”test.txt”的所有者改为当前用户。
5. 将”test.txt”的所有者改为”root”用户。练习题4:进程管理命令
1. 查看当前系统中正在运行的所有进程。
2. 查找名为”firefox”的进程。
3. 结束名为”firefox”的进程。
4. 后台运行一个名为”example”的程序。练习题5:网络命令
1. 查看当前系统的网络连接情况。
2. 查看本机的IP地址。
3. 使用ping命令测试一个远程主机的可达性。
4. 使用curl命令下载一个网页。练习题6:压缩解压命令
1. 创建一个名为”test”的文件夹,并在该文件夹中创建一个名为”file1.txt”的文件。
2. 将”test”文件夹压缩为一个名为”test.tar.gz”的压缩包。
3. 解压”test.tar.gz”压缩包。
4. 将”test”文件夹压缩为一个名为”test.zip”的压缩包。
5. 解压”test.zip”压缩包。练习题7:系统信息命令
1. 查看当前系统的内核版本。
2. 查看当前系统的文件系统使用情况。
3. 查看当前系统的CPU信息。
4. 查看当前系统的内存使用情况。练习题8:用户管理命令
1. 创建一个名为”test”的用户。
2. 将”test”用户添加到”sudo”用户组。
3. 将”test”用户的登录Shell修改为/bin/bash。
4. 禁用”test”用户的登录权限。
5. 删除”test”用户。练习题9:软件包管理命令
1. 更新系统上已安装的所有软件包。
2. 安装一个名为”example”的软件包。
3. 卸载名为”example”的软件包。
4. 在软件包数据库中搜索名为”example”的软件包。练习题10:日志管理命令
1. 查看系统日志文件/var/log/syslog的最后10行。
2. 在日志文件/var/log/syslog中搜索关键词”error”。
3. 将日志文件/var/log/syslog中的内容保存到一个名为”log.txt”的文件中。以上练习题主要涵盖了Linux系统基础命令的使用,包括文件操作、文件查找、文件权限、进程管理、网络命令、压缩解压、系统信息、用户管理、软件包管理以及日志管理等方面的练习。通过完成这些练习题,可以加深对Linux命令的理解和熟练度,提高对Linux系统的操作能力。
2年前